<br />EXTRACT OF MINUTES OF MEETING OF THE <br /> <br />C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F ROSEVILLE <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/>. <br /> <br />Pursuant to due call and notice thereof, a regular meeting of the City <br />Council of the City of Roseville, County of Ramsey, Minnesota, was duly held in <br />the City Hall at 2660 Civic Center Drive, Roseville, Minnesota, on Monday, the <br />fourteenth day of April, 1986, at 7:30 o'clock p.m. <br /> <br />The following members were present: Kehr, Matson, Johnson, Kehr, Demos. <br /> <br />and the following were absent: None. <br /> <br />Member Johnson introduced the following resolution and moved its adoption: <br /> <br />RESOLUTION NO. 7885 <br /> <br />RESOLUTION REQUESTING RAMSEY COUNTY <br /> <br />TO RESTRICT PARKING ALONG A PORTION OF COUNTY ROAD B <br /> <br />WHEREAS, the County has planned the improvement of County Road B (CSAH 25) <br />from Cleveland Avenue to Trunk Highway 51; and <br /> <br />WHEREAS, the County will be expending County State Aid Highway funds <br />(S.A.P. 62-625-11) on the improvement of said street; and <br /> <br />WHEREAS, said improvement does not conform to the approved minimum standards as <br />previously adopted for such County State Aid streets and that approval of the <br />proposed construction as a County State Aid street project must, therefore, be <br />conditioned upon certain parking restrictions; and <br /> <br />WHEREAS, the extent of these restrictions, that would be a necessary <br />prerequisite to the approval of this construction as a County State Aid project <br />in the City, has been determined. <br /> <br />NOW, THEREFORE, IT IS HEREBY RESOLVED, that the City requests the County to <br />restrict the parking of motor vehicles on both sides of County Road B from <br />Cleveland Avenue to Trunk Highway 51. <br /> <br />The motion for the adoption of the foregoing resolution was duly seconded <br />by Member Kehr and upon vote being taken thereon, the following voted <br />in favor thereof: Demos, Kehr, Johnson, Matson, Cushman. <br /> <br />and the following voted against same: None. <br /> <br />whereupon said resolution was declared dUly passed and adopted. <br />
